I'm in the middle of an engine swap between my '87 NA GXL and my '86 NA Base. The '86 engine is going into the '87 b/c the '87 has no rear rotor compression.

As it sits, the '86 engine isnt out yet, but it will be soon. Because this is my first experience with the 13B NA Rotary engine, I'm asking if anyone wants to post some advice on what to do after its out. The '86 has about 130k on it, wasnt treated too well before I bought it, and just has a lot of wear and tear in general.

I would say to check out the transmission front cover gasket, and make sure it's not leaking. A new throwout bearing would be a good idea. If you can get the pilot bearing out then changing both it and the seal would be a good idea.
